Parrot Analytics' demand data reveals valuable insights to entertainment executives working at different stages of the content creation and distribution process. Let's take the example of the popular TV show "Ted Lasso", which has been creating a buzz in Mexico. The following questions will help you understand how Parrot Analytics' demand data can help you make informed content, acquisition, distribution, and programming-related decisions.

- Content Valuation: "Ted Lasso" has 8.7 times the audience demand of the average show in Mexico over the last 30 days, which indicates its high value to Mexican audiences. Moreover, this information can help you to estimate the dollar value contribution of this title to your platform or to a specific region in Mexico.

- Content Acquisition: The show moved up seven spots, achieving a peak rank of #89 in Mexico. Additionally, other shows that fans of "Ted Lasso" also like are "Foundation", "The Last Of Us", "Rick And Morty", "Silo", "Succession", "What We Do In The Shadows", "Ahsoka", "Star Trek: Strange New Worlds" and "Only Murders In The Building". Using this data, you can identify similar shows to "Ted Lasso" that are in demand and may be worth acquiring for your platform.

- Content Distribution: The show's travelability, which measures the show's international demand relative to its home market, is exceptional. Moreover, the information about the top 10 global markets where "Ted Lasso" is most in-demand over the last 30 days can help you to identify new areas where the show may be popular, making it worth distributing in those regions.

- Programming Decisions: The audience demand for the show has increased in Mexico by 13.8% over the last month, indicating the growing popularity of the show among Mexican audiences. Moreover, "Ted Lasso" stands at the 99.8th percentile in the drama genre, indicating that it has higher demand than 99.8% of all drama titles in Mexico. This can help you to make informed programming decisions by including this show in your programming lineup, specifically for Mexican audiences.

- Longevity and Momentum: The demand for "Ted Lasso" in Mexico was 27% of the demand in its country of origin, the United States. Additionally, the show's longevity, which measures how well audience demand is maintained over time, is outstanding. Keeping this information in mind, you can make decisions about content that will maintain demand over time. Additionally, the momentum, which measures the pace of growth, is exceptional. These insights could help to ensure that your content choices are keeping up with trends and growth in demand.
